Finance Review Summary — Calder & Wynn Partnership

For branch managers: we have completed our review of the term sheet received from Calder & Wynn regarding the proposed distribution partnership for the Nimbrel product line. Proposed margins are acceptable, though the exclusivity clause for the Ardenvale region requires renegotiation. Counsel expects revised terms within two weeks. Further strategic context is set out in the confidential note below.

board note of fahif-yahog: Gross margin on Wenath came in at 10 percent against a plan of 5 percent. Only 3 of the 100 pilot accounts renewed Wenath, so a churn review is set for July 15.

Changelog — Threadle Autocomplete Core 5.2 (plugin authors)

Defaults changed. Slow index rebuilds were traced to the per-plugin tokenizer chain, so the core now caps tokenizer passes at three and batches index writes. Plugins relying on unbounded passes must declare an override or they'll be truncated silently. Shard warm-up also moved to lazy mode; expect first-query latency instead of startup cost. Test against 5.2 before publishing. New shipped defaults are given in the configuration block below.

config for tagep-yajef:
ulawyn:
  log_level: error
  metrics_host: metrics.ulawyn.lumiclabs.internal
  pin: 0564
  pool_size: 32

[ ] Step 7 — Queuewarden autoscaler key rotation. Release manager: before signing the new scaling-policy keys for the Queuewarden queue-depth autoscaler, verify both ceremony witnesses have initialed the log and that the Fernbridge HSM shows a clean attestation. Once verified, unseal the escrow envelope containing the rotation credentials. The envelope opens only with the recovery passphrase recorded immediately below.

unlock words, yawig-kagef: gordor-holvan-ulaael-pramir-ulaiel-tamdor

Runbook: Tax-Rate Lookup Cache (Tollgate)

New team members should know that Tollgate caches tax-rate lookups for 24 hours per jurisdiction. A stale entry can cause incorrect totals, so never extend the TTL without approval from the rates team. If a jurisdiction publishes an emergency rate change, invalidate that key manually rather than flushing the whole cache, which causes a thundering-herd spike on the upstream resolver. The invalidation procedure, with step-by-step commands, is documented on the internal page here.

operations page: https://jenkins.zemvarcloud.local/job/merge_requests/repo/build/73930b4b30f0a8ed